Manchester United boss Sir Alex Ferguson made a personal check on Celtic midfielder Victor Wanyama last night. The Scottish Sun says he was in Glasgow to pay his respects to Sean Fallon.
It's common knowledge the Manchester United boss is a big fan of the Kenyan. His scouts have been Celtic regulars this season.
In town for today's funeral of Fallon, Jock Stein's assistant, he took the chance to watch Wanyama in the flesh for the first time.
The 21-year-old didn't disappoint with a top display in front of the legendary Scot.
He powered in a header, rattled the post and offered a glimpse of his huge potential against Dundee United.
